Introduction
Understanding how to add schema markup to WordPress can transform your website’s visibility and performance in search engine results. Schema markup is a form of microdata that helps search engines understand your content better, which can lead to rich snippets, improved click-through rates, and ultimately more traffic to your site. In this comprehensive guide, we’ll explore the different aspects of schema markup, including its benefits, practical use cases, and step-by-step instructions on how to implement it on your WordPress site.
What is Schema Markup
Schema markup is structured data that you can add to your website code. It provides additional context to your content, allowing search engines like Google and Bing to understand it better. This extra layer of information can improve how your web pages appear in search results, potentially leading to better engagement and increased website traffic.
Benefits of Implementing Schema Markup
Adding schema markup to your WordPress site has several benefits:
- Enhanced Visibility: Schema markup can create rich snippets, which are visually appealing and attract more clicks.
- Improved SEO: While schema itself is not a ranking factor, the increased click-through rate can positively affect your search engine rankings.
- Better User Experience: Providing users with clear, concise information in search results helps them find what they need quickly.
- Voice Search Optimization: As voice search becomes more prevalent, schema markup can improve how well your content fits search queries.
Types of Schema Markup
There are various schema types you can utilize depending on your content. Here are a few common ones:
Article Schema
Use this schema to denote blog posts or news articles, ensuring titles, images, and publication dates are highlighted.
Product Schema
If you run an e-commerce site, product schema captures key details like price, availability, and reviews for your items.
Event Schema
Event schema provides details about upcoming events, including dates, locations, and ticket information.
Local Business Schema
This schema is perfect for businesses with physical locations, detailing information such as address, contact info, and business hours.
How to Add Schema Markup to WordPress
Now that you understand what schema markup is and its benefits, let’s dive into how to add it to your WordPress site.
Using Schema Plugins
The easiest way to add schema markup to WordPress is to use one of the many available plugins. Popular options include:
These plugins often come with user-friendly interfaces to help you easily add schema markup without any coding required.
Manually Adding Schema Markup
If you prefer not to use a plugin, you can manually add schema markup to your site. Here’s how:
- Identify the relevant schema types for your content from the Schema.org website.
- Generate the JSON-LD (JavaScript Object Notation for Linked Data) code using a tool such as Technical SEO’s Schema Markup Generator.
- Copy the generated JSON-LD code and add it to your WordPress site using a custom HTML block in the Gutenberg editor or in the header or footer section of your theme.
Using Google Tag Manager
If you’re using Google Tag Manager, you can implement schema markup without changing your theme or plugin settings. Simply create a new tag, select “Custom HTML,” and paste your JSON-LD code.
Use Cases of Schema Markup
Using schema markup can enhance various types of content on your site. Here are some practical use cases:
Blog Posts
When you add article schema to your blog posts, you can highlight authors, publish dates, and images, increasing your chances of appearing as a rich snippet in search results.
Restaurant Websites
Local business schema can reveal essential information like your restaurant’s menu, reservation system, and hours of operation directly in search results.
E-commerce Sites
By implementing product schema, customers can see product ratings, price information, and availability on search pages, encouraging clicks.
Events
If you host events, using event schema can ensure potential attendees see event details right from the search results page.
Tips for Effective Schema Markup
Here are some actionable tips to ensure your schema markup is effective:
Keep It Consistent
Make sure the schema markup matches the content on your page. Misleading information can lead to penalties from search engines.
Use the Right Vocabulary
Refer to Schema.org to find the correct types and properties for the markup you’re implementing.
Test Your Schema Markup
After adding schema to your site, test it using the Google Rich Results Test to ensure everything is correctly implemented.
Stay Updated
Schema markup evolves, and Google frequently updates its guidelines. Stay informed about new types and best practices to maintain your site’s performance.
Comparing Plugins for Schema Markup
When choosing a plugin to add schema markup, consider the following factors:
Ease of Use
Some plugins have a steeper learning curve than others. Choose one that matches your technical skill level.
Features Offered
Some plugins provide built-in support for multiple schema types, while others might be specialized. Select one that meets your specific needs.
Support and Updates
Check if the plugin is regularly updated and has good user support, which can be crucial for resolving issues quickly.
Conclusion
Adding schema markup to your WordPress site can significantly enhance your SEO efforts, improve visibility, and provide a better experience for users. Whether you choose to use a plugin, manually add code, or leverage Google Tag Manager, taking the time to implement schema markup is well worth the effort. So, why wait? Start optimizing your site today and reap the rewards.
For more assistance, consider checking out our Free Website Audit to see how your site is performing and learn more about the advantages of schema markup. If you have questions or need further assistance, feel free to reach out through our Contact Support page.
How to Add Schema Markup to WordPress: FAQ Guide
What is Schema Markup and Why Use It?
How Do I Check if Schema Markup is Working?
Can I Use Plugins to Add Schema Markup?
What Plugins Are Best for Adding Schema Markup?
Is Manual Addition of Schema Markup Complicated?
What Types of Schema Markup Can I Add?
How to Add Schema Markup to Custom Post Types?
Can Schema Markup Improve My Search Rankings?
What Are Common Mistakes to Avoid with Schema Markup?
Where Can I Get More Help on Schema Markup?
